Transaction 7532820e2d27da994b6ac47e0558680a4113d3c114d206cd1f17d4884811607d
1 Input
1 Output
-
7532820e2d27da994b6ac47e0558680a4113d3c114d206cd1f17d4884811607d:0
- value
- 25931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d4b8bf3a4cd607729983b7f0e45ecc54a151682 OP_EQUAL
- address
- 32uKD7XYzoJfnRAYeEhNtEEuU1goGLjMki